What is Film Faced Plywood?

Film faced plywood composed of several layers of veneer which are held together with a the strength of adhesive. The surface is covered by an insulating film, typically Melamine or phenolic. This creates an even, sealed and durable surface.

Common specifications are:

  • Thickness: The majority of sheets are made of 12mm, 15mm, 18mm or 21mm depending on the needs of the structure.
  • Colors: Black as well as brown, are most commonly used colors, however dark green, red and even custom colors are available.
  • Environmental grades: For indoor use, buyers can pick E0 and E1 classes which meet the latest standards for indoor air quality.

Key Indoor Advantages of Film Faced Plywood

Although the construction industry is awestruck by film faced plywood due to its durability and reusability interior designers love it for different sets of motives. The following are the three primary advantages that help it different in indoor settings.

1. Moisture Resistance, Anti-Mold, and Easy Maintenance

One of the biggest challenges for bathroom and kitchen design is the issue of humidity. The traditional plywood typically expands and expands, or deforms, or creates mold spots after exposure to water. Film-faced plywood however, is much more effective in these situations. The protective film serves as a barrier to water that prevents moisture from entering the core of wood.

Cleaning is also easy. A damp cloth suffices to remove dirt, grease, or dust. This is why it is particularly helpful in areas with high traffic and where hygiene is essential.

2.Scratch Resistance and Impact Durability

Comparatively the Laminate MDF and particle boards film-faced plywood is more durable. It is resistant to scratches from books, cutlery and everyday household chores. The plywood’s multi-layered design offers it a great load-bearing capability that makes it suitable for furniture that will have to withstand regular use, like tables for dining, work desks or shelving units.

For commercial spaces such as cafes and booths for exhibitions Durability means a more years of service and less replacement costs.

3. Industrial Aesthetic and Reduced Finishing Costs

Another benefit that is often overlooked is the attractiveness of the film-faced plywood. Melamine or phenolic film provides a smooth industrial look that usually removes the need for further layers or coatings. Designers can enjoy its natural minimalist aesthetic as a an element of contemporary or industrial designs for interiors.

If you use film faced plywood as a finishing material, both the labor and the cost of secondary treatments can be cut down. This is an effective combination of design and function.

Indoor Application Scenarios for Film Faced Plywood

Film faced plywood could be originally construction materials, however its beauty and performance are suitable for many indoor applications. Here are five instances where it is a viable option.

Kitchens 

The kitchen is considered to be an extremely difficult areas in a home. The surfaces must withstand the heat, steam, grease and constant cleaning. film-faced plywood is the ideal choice for this area.

For cabinets, its moisture resistance plays a crucial function in preventing cabinets from warping and ensuring the stability of furniture used for storage. When used in cooking islands in the kitchen, it’s tough surface can withstand chopping the load of heavy pans and continuous contact with everyday kitchen tasks, ensuring the condition of the furniture even in regular use. In the case of splash walls the film-faced plywood panel could be substituted for tiles to create contemporary seamless and easy to clean backsplash that adds both practicality and an elegant look to kitchens.

Through combining practicality and fashion film faced plywood allows homeowners to create kitchens that aren’t just functional, but also distinctive that meet the daily requirements and aesthetic preferences.

Bathrooms

Bathrooms require materials that can withstand moisture, water splashes as well as cleaning chemical. Film faced plywood is a good choice as a strong base for:

  • Cabinets that house toiletries and are resistant to the effects of moisture.
  • Partitions that divide dry and wet zones, ensuring security and privacy.
  • Wall niches or shelves for storage, blending functionality with elegant design.

Its water-proofing and anti-mold properties guarantee long-term durability which makes it an ideal improvement over traditional MDF.
